To provide high quality and timely legal secretarial and administrative support within the Government Insurance and Risk team. Assist and support the executive legal secretary with effective training and coaching of legal secretaries to ensure that quality services are provided.

Seeking applicants who can demonstrate the following skills and abilities:

  • Performs well with frequent interruptions and/or distractions.
  • Completes workload within established timeframes and adjusts priorities quickly as circumstances dictate.
  • Works independently and identifies more effective methods of work operation.
  • Sets priorities that accurately reflect the relative importance of job and responsibilities.
  • Speaks effectively with persons of various social, cultural, economic and educational backgrounds.
  • Contributes to workplace equity, diversity, respect and inclusion that enriches our culture of respect and inclusion.
  • Establishes and maintains co-operative working relationships with co-workers and the public.
  • Negotiates or exchanges ideas, information and opinions with others to formulate policies and programs and/or arrive jointly at decisions, conclusions or solutions.
